Got a late invite to run with a couple great guys and ran out of West Port... Left the house at 0230hrs and was on the water by 0530hrs... We did good - limited across the board with both Chinooks and Silvers... Most boats - according to the fish checker did not do so well and only a couple of boats limited... My go to favorite - Coho Killer wasn't doing it for me, even though I stayed stubborn til I needed action. Switched to small cut herring plug, 55 ft out in between the jetties at 4 miles or so, 95 ft of water.. A couple earlier Silvers were at 30 ft - north jetty area. "No salmon secrets in the salt".
(thinking of changing my boat name to that
) The fish won't be there tomorrow anyhow... Bang them while we can and get our table fare frozen... A great kick off to the 2013 salt water salmon season... Now for getting the barbeque ready.... Fish checker cut the heads off a couple others that had trackers in them..
